Willie Colón, American trombonist, composer, bandleader, and activist who helped to popularize salsa music in the United States in the 1970s.

After that primary, Colón endorsed then candidate Betsy Gotbaum for Public Advocate , who was handily elected.
Willie Colón ran in New York City's 2001 Democratic primary as a Candidate for Public Advocate of the City of New York, garnering a respectable 101,394 votes.
Willie Colón campaigned and later became a special assistant and spokesperson for the first African- American mayor of New York City, David Dinkins from 1989 to 1993.
